Output 68351627b02cfa7046fd1b60b39c4d4300bbbcf71021dc2e8bf4f886f930352e:34

value
641779
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 83d42b92d1a5214b9376cc98502f8828fe34b5fe OP_EQUALVERIFY OP_CHECKSIG
address
1D23gyWiRC5ws3qgg8ri6TuAszUeuSU9ra
transaction
68351627b02cfa7046fd1b60b39c4d4300bbbcf71021dc2e8bf4f886f930352e